UI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2016 in Review

150 of the 3,767 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Ubiquiti (UI) for Q1 2016, worth a combined $933M — up 3.2% from $904M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 34 funds opened new UI positions and 24 closed out — a net gain of 10 holders — while 57 added to existing stakes and 42 trimmed.

The largest buyer was EdgePoint Investment Group, adding an estimated $28.5M. The largest seller was HHR Asset Management, exiting entirely with an estimated $29.9M sold.
